Lorenzo Insigne has been often linked with a move to Liverpool.

Napoli star Lorenzo Insigne likes Liverpool boss Jurgen Klopp ‘so much’, according to a report from Corriere Dello Sport.
Insigne has long been linked with a move to Liverpool and The Sun claimed that Klopp had a £61 million bid rebuffed in January.
With the summer window fast approaching, the Reds are bound to be linked again after Corriere Dello Sport claim that the 27-year-old winger – valued at £131 million [The Mirror] – is a big fan of the German manager.
But the report adds that Insigne is also ‘bewitched’ by former Napoli and current Chelsea boss Maurizio Sarri, under whom he established himself as a household name in Italy.
Corriere also claims that Paris Saint-Germain could enter the market for Insigne, whose contract at Stadio San Paolo expires in 2022.
It’s probably not good for Liverpool if PSG are legitimately interested, given the French giants’ financial power.
They are much more likely to meet Napoli’s reported £131 million valuation, while Sarri’s presence in West London should also represent a concern for Klopp if he is still – or was ever – interested.
